The Professional Certificate in Techniques for Advanced Levels of Data Analysis in Research is a comprehensive program designed to equip learners with the skills and knowledge required to analyze complex data sets and draw meaningful conclusions.
This program focuses on advanced data analysis techniques, including machine learning, statistical modeling, and data visualization, which are essential for researchers and professionals working in various fields such as business, social sciences, and healthcare.
Upon completion of the program, learners can expect to gain the following learning outcomes: the ability to design and implement advanced data analysis projects, the skill to interpret and communicate complex data insights, and the knowledge to apply data analysis techniques to real-world problems.
The duration of the program is typically 4-6 months, with learners completing a series of online courses and assignments that are designed to be completed at their own pace.
